ALM:KULTUR in Saalfelden Leogang
Salzburg Alpine Summer for culture vultures
Tradition meets modernity – that’s the motto of the art and culture projects held in the surrounding Alpine pastures every week from July to September as part of the Salzburg Alpine Summer. With a programme ranging from concerts and readings to dance and carving workshops, the Alpine pastures are transformed into cultural hotspots that bridge the gap between old customs and future developments.
Summer 2025: 11th July – 05th September
Saalfelden Leogang
Art meets the Alpine pastures – that’s the motto of the hikes that lead culture and art enthusiasts through the pastures in Saalfelden Leogang every Friday. These hikes are extremely popular, as they take what is already a beautiful day of hiking and turn it into a unique experience. It’s not unusual for people to spontaneously listen in and join the hikes, as they’re delighted to stumble upon an event that’s truly different.

The ALM:KULTUR is a series of events that places a special emphasis on ecological, social and economic sustainability and was awarded as a "Green Event Salzburg" for this extraordinary commitment.
Under the motto ‘Tradition meets modernity’, workshops and concerts were once again organised on a total of 6 mountain pastures on eight consecutive Fridays in 2024. From traditional music and jazz to a painting workshop, there was something for everyone this year.
